I am the author of three books for teens with the fourth, Bluefish, scheduled for release from Candlewick Press in the fall of 2011.

I love to visit middle and high school classrooms and talk about a range of subjects, including creativity in general, favorite books, sensory detail in writing, and the fun and power of writing from the heart. I come armed with questions, games, and topics for discussion.

I am also happy to speak with adults on a variety of topics, including two that I can tailor as lecture or workshop:

  • The Fictive Dream - How to enter the dream, stay there,
                                       and transmit it to others
  • Fierce Revision - Love your rewrites

Awards and Honors

    Circle the Truth
  • Minnesota State Arts Board fellowship grant, 2003
  • Outstanding Books for Children by a Wisconsin Author, Wisconsin Library Association, 2008
  • Best Children’s Books of the Year selection, Bank Street College of Education, 2008.

    Mousetraps
  • Tofte/Wright Children's Literature Award from the Council for Wisconsin Writer, 2008
  • Finalist for the Lambda Literary Award in the LGBT children's/YA category, 2008

    Bluefish
  • The PEN/Phyllis Naylor Working Writer Fellowship, 2010
